What's your suggestion then?  That's the whole point of my post. Heavier overall, different broadhead?

If it were me I’d be shooting 70plus lbs 500+grains with a 3to1 style 125plus grain broad head. 3 blade or 2 but long and skinny. 

How heavy is your total arrow now? What are all the specs of your set up.
